For the floors I used Balsa wood that you find at Bunnings, and cut tiny planks to create like a laminate floor, and I also used some old woven mats so it looks like a jute floor which is super cute. What did you use to change out all the walls and floors? First I painted it all in white to have a clean base to work on and then I painted a few walls with left over paints I had from other projects, I also used some leftover wallpaper from the one that Ambre has in her bedroom. Where did you buy the dolls house itself? It was a shelf from Aldi, just an ugly house shaped shelf but I saw the potential straight away.
